A melanocyte (mole) is a certain sort of pigment-producing cell that resides in the skin. These melanocytes are located periodically in "typical" skin, yet can expand in nests to create moles. Make a visit with your physician or various other health care specialist if you discover any skin changes that fret you. A lot of moles begin appearing in childhood and brand-new moles may form up until regarding age 40. By the time they are adults, many people have between 10 and 40 moles. Seborrheic keratoses can range in color from very light tone to deep, dark black. It is these deeply pigmented SKs that frequently show up worrying and bring clients right into the office. Some cancer malignancies develop from moles that aren't on sun-exposed skin, however the biggest proportion of melanomas lie in sun-exposed locations. Lighter skin type is an added threat variable that makes sun exposure also riskier. Just rarely does a dysplastic mole become melanoma (1, 3). However, dysplastic nevi are a danger aspect for developing melanoma, and the even more dysplastic mole a person has, the higher their risk of creating melanoma (1, 3). Irregular moles may be mistaken for melanoma, yet are not always malignant or precancerous. However, despite the fact that a private atypical mole might be benign, individuals that have dysplastic moles go to raised risk of creating melanoma compared to those that do not. Melanoma can develop in a mole or elsewhere on the body. Yes, atypical moles called dysplastic nevi can appear like cancer malignancy even though they are benign. The only method to learn for sure whether a mole is benign or malignant is to carry out a biopsy, which involves taking an example of skin cells.
